The book "Constructions of Gender in Late Antique Manichaean Cosmological Narrative: Studia Traditionis Theologiae Explorations in Early and Medieval Theology 34" offers an in-depth analysis of the gender dynamics within the context of Manichaeism, a religious movement that emerged in Persia during the third century CE and flourished across the Roman Empire and Central Asia until being persecuted in the eighth to ninth centuries. The founder of Manichaeism, Mani, claimed to be the final embodiment of a series of prophets sent over time to expound divine wisdom. This monograph delves into the gendered divinities embedded in Mani's cosmological narrative, which depicts a conflict between gendered deities and the demonic forces of the Kingdom of Darkness. The study explores the Jewish and Gnostic roots of these gender constructions and how they evolved over time, reflecting the changing circumstances of the Manichaean community.
